Installation Assistant information

What is an installation assistant?

Installation Assistants are professionals who help with the setup, assembly, and installation of equipment, systems, or products at a job site or customer location. They typically work under the guidance of a lead installer or supervisor, handling tasks such as unloading materials, preparing work areas, following installation instructions, and ensuring tools and components are ready. Installation Assistants may work in industries like construction, telecommunications, or home services. Their role is crucial for ensuring installations are completed safely, efficiently, and according to specifications.

What does an installation assistant do?

As an Installation Assistant, your day typically begins with reviewing project assignments and gathering necessary tools and materials. You'll work under the guidance of a lead installer, assisting with tasks such as unpacking equipment, preparing installation sites, and handling components during the setup process. Collaboration is key—Installation Assistants often coordinate closely with team members to ensure safety protocols are followed and installations are completed efficiently. Communication and adaptability are important, as job sites and client needs can vary daily. This hands-on role provides valuable experience and opportunities for advancement to lead installer or technician positions.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an installation assistant?

To thrive as an Installation Assistant, you need basic mechanical aptitude, familiarity with installation procedures, and often a high school diploma or equivalent. Experience with hand and power tools, as well as knowledge of safety protocols and sometimes OSHA certification, is typically required. Strong teamwork, attention to detail, and effective communication are valuable soft skills in this role. These abilities ensure safe, accurate, and efficient installations while supporting team productivity and client satisfaction.

What is the difference between Installation Assistant vs Installer?

AspectInstallation AssistantInstaller
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; may require basic technical trainingHigh school diploma; technical certifications or training often preferred
Work EnvironmentAssist with setup and support tasks, often indoors or on-sitePerform installation, assembly, and troubleshooting, often on-site at customer locations
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in retail, appliance, and technology sectors for support rolesCommon in construction, manufacturing, and technical services for hands-on installation

While both roles support installation processes, the Installation Assistant primarily provides support and preparatory tasks, whereas the Installer performs the actual installation and setup. The roles often overlap but differ mainly in responsibility level and technical expertise required.

Is being an installation assistant a good career path?

Installation assistants perform tasks such as installing, maintaining, and repairing equipment or systems, often requiring physical activity and technical skills. It can be a good entry-level career with opportunities for skill development and advancement into specialized or supervisory roles, especially with experience and relevant certifications. The job environment varies but typically involves working on-site with tools and equipment.
